Dowa Eco-System magnet recycling is the focus of a new demonstration test announced by Dowa Holdings Co., Ltd. The company said its subsidiary, Dowa Eco-System Co., Ltd., will test technology designed to recover and recycle rare-earth magnets used in electrified vehicle drive motors. The project is intended to establish an efficient process for recovering used rare-earth magnets and returning the recovered resources to circulation. The initiative builds on Dowa Eco-System’s previous development of technology for recovering rare-earth magnets from motors used in household electric appliances, providing an existing technical foundation for the new vehicle-focused demonstration.

The demonstration will apply Dowa Eco-System’s proprietary resource recovery process and sorting technology to rare-earth magnets contained in electrified vehicle drive motors. Rather than focusing only on recovery from a single component stream, the project is designed around collaboration with other companies that make up relevant supply chains. This approach is intended to help establish practical and efficient recovery and recycling processes for magnets obtained from electrified vehicle applications. The test therefore connects Dowa Eco-System’s existing recovery capabilities with a broader supply-chain framework for handling materials recovered from used vehicle motors.

A key objective is to recover rare-earth magnets from end-of-life electrified vehicles and recycle them as part of a domestic resource circulation process. Rare-earth magnets are used in drive motors, making their recovery relevant to the treatment of electrified vehicles after they reach the end of their useful lives. By developing a process specifically for magnets contained in vehicle drive motors, Dowa Eco-System is extending its resource recovery work beyond household electric appliances. The demonstration is intended to provide the process knowledge needed to improve efficient recovery and sorting as vehicle-derived magnet recycling develops.
